Step by step overview on how to withdraw Monero (XMR) from Huobi

Withdrawing funds from your Huobi account is easy. However, prior to making deposit and withdrawal transactions, you have to go through verification processes to ensure your safety.

Here, you will find steps that you can follow in withdrawing funds from Huobi account.

Once the site is up, log-in with your registered account.

After logging in, go to “Balances” and select the currency you want to withdraw. You can either type in your Monero (XMR) or manually search it from the list. In this example, we are using BTC.

Click on “Withdraw.”

Key in the Monero (XMR) address as well as your amount. Make sure the correct Monero (XMR) address is entered to avoid losing your money permanently as withdrawal transactions can no longer be reverted.

Click on “Withdraw.”

The Security authentication box will pop-up. Input the codes needed and click on “Confirm.” The next page is for you to submit the required documents. Once submitted, it’ll be processed within 30 minutes.

If this step is skipped, you need to wait for a call within 24 hours to go through phone verification from an officer in charge.

Click on “History” to monitor the status of your withdrawal. Remember that 6/6 confirmation must be met.

Step by step overview on how to deposit Monero (XMR) on OKEx

With OKEx, you can deposit cryptocurrencies like Monero (XMR). Fiat money deposit is not yet an option at the moment. However, it is available through OKCoin.

Here are the steps on how to deposit funds on your registered and confirmed OKEx account.

Log in using the email address and password you’ve filed for OKEx.

Select your Monero (XMR) under “Token Deposit.” We are using Bitcoin in this example.

Copy the current deposit address or select your wallet address by clicking on “Address history.” It is a must to copy the correct address before submitting the transaction. Otherwise, you may lose control of your Monero (XMR) as it can no longer be reverted.

You can check your pending and processed transactions by going to “History.”
